View Game8 View Game87%Game Brain Scoregameplay, storygrinding, stability89% User Score 11,506 reviewsCritic Score 75%1 reviewsIn Five Nights at Freddy's 3, players become a night guard at a horror attraction based on the shuttered Freddy Fazbear's Pizza. Using security cameras and limited power resources, they must survive against animatronic horrors, including the phantom animatronics from the past. The game introduces a new terror, Springtrap, a decaying animatronic survivor of a past tragedy, seeking to avoid destruction and escape into the world once again.
